JUCE
|
A listener for user selection events in a file browser. More...
Public Member Functions | |
virtual | ~FileBrowserListener () |
Destructor. More... | |
virtual void | selectionChanged ()=0 |
Callback when the user selects a different file in the browser. More... | |
virtual void | fileClicked (const File &file, const MouseEvent &e)=0 |
Callback when the user clicks on a file in the browser. More... | |
virtual void | fileDoubleClicked (const File &file)=0 |
Callback when the user double-clicks on a file in the browser. More... | |
virtual void | browserRootChanged (const File &newRoot)=0 |
Callback when the browser's root folder changes. More... | |
A listener for user selection events in a file browser.
This is used by a FileBrowserComponent or FileListComponent.
|
virtual |
Destructor.
|
pure virtual |
Callback when the user selects a different file in the browser.
Implemented in FileBrowserComponent.
|
pure virtual |
Callback when the user clicks on a file in the browser.
Implemented in FileBrowserComponent.
|
pure virtual |
Callback when the user double-clicks on a file in the browser.
Implemented in FileBrowserComponent.
|
pure virtual |
Callback when the browser's root folder changes.
Implemented in FileBrowserComponent.